| This article is about the heroic Decepticon. For his evil counterpart, see Lockdown (ROTF). For a list of other meanings, see Lockdown (disambiguation). |
- Lockdown is a heroic Decepticon from the Shattered Glass continuity family.

Lockdown is a host for a fourth wall-breaking show.
Fiction
[edit]SD SG
[edit]For some reason, Lockdown was present to listen to Optimus Prime whine through the fourth wall. SD SG #1
Notes
[edit]- Lockdown's appearance in SD SG is a nod to the movieverse version of Lockdown's role as a main character of the Q-Transformers cartoon, which SD SG is inspired by.
- Lockdown's body is modeled on the Thrilling 30 Deluxe Class Trailcutter toy while the colors come from a sheriff's vehicle in the TV series Eureka.[1][2]
- Jesse Wittenrich and Josh Perez had an idea that in contrast to how the original Lockdown stole upgrades as trophies, Shattered Lockdown never changed his equipment per the characterization of a small-town sheriff.[3]
